当前位置:Gxlcms > mysql > linux下oracle10g安装

linux下oracle10g安装

时间:2021-07-01 10:21:17 帮助过:11人阅读

欢迎进入Oracle社区论坛,与200万技术人员互动交流 >>进入 一,基本配置: 1.以root登录,挂载linux iso文件 [root@oracle ~]# hostname oracle.junjie.com [root@oracle ~]# cat /etc/sysconfig/network NETWORKING=yes NETWORKING_IPV6=no HOSTNAME=oracle

欢迎进入Oracle社区论坛,与200万技术人员互动交流 >>进入

一,基本配置:

1.以root登录,挂载linux iso文件

[root@oracle ~]# hostname

oracle.junjie.com

[root@oracle ~]# cat /etc/sysconfig/network

NETWORKING=yes

NETWORKING_IPV6=no

HOSTNAME=oracle.junjie.com

[root@oracle ~]# ifconfig eth0

eth0 Link encap:Ethernet HWaddr 00:0C:29:65:FC:1D

inet addr:192.168.101.88 Bcast:192.168.101.255 Mask:255.255.255.0

[root@oracle ~]# mkdir /mnt/cdrom/

[root@oracle ~]# mount /dev/cdrom /mnt/cdrom/

mount: block device /dev/cdrom is write-protected, mounting read-only

2. 检查包是否安装

[root@oracle ~]# cd /mnt/cdrom/Server/

libXp-1.0.0-8.1.el5.i386.rpm

binutils-2.17.50.0.6-12.el5.i386.rpm

compat-db-4.2.52-5.1.i386.rpm

compat-libstdc++-296-2.96-138.i386.rpm

control-center-2.16.0-16.el5.i386.rpm

gcc-4.1.2-46.el5.i386.rpm

gcc-c++-4.1.2-46.el5.i386.rpm

glibc-2.5-42.i386.rpm

glibc-common-2.5-42.i386.rpm

libstdc++-4.1.2-46.el5.i386.rpm

libstdc++-devel-4.1.2-46.el5.i386.rpm

make-3.81-3.el5.i386.rpm

pdksh-5.2.14-36.el5.i386.rpm

sysstat-7.0.2-3.el5.i386.rpm

setarch-2.0-1.1.i386.rpm

[root@oracle Server]# rpm -ivh libXp-1.0.0-8.1.el5.i386.rpm

[root@oracle Server]# rpm -ivh binutils-2.17.50.0.6-12.el5.i386.rpm

[root@oracle Server]# rpm -ivh compat-db-4.2.52-5.1.i386.rpm

[root@oracle Server]# rpm -ivh compat-libstdc++-296-2.96-138.i386.rpm

[root@oracle Server]# rpm -ivh control-center-2.16.0-16.el5.i386.rpm

[root@oracle Server]# rpm -ivh gcc-4.1.2-46.el5.i386.rpm

[root@oracle Server]# rpm -ivh gcc-c++-4.1.2-46.el5.i386.rpm

[root@oracle Server]# rpm -ivh glibc-2.5-42.i386.rpm

[root@oracle Server]# rpm -ivh glibc-common-2.5-42.i386.rpm

[root@oracle Server]# rpm -ivh libstdc++-4.1.2-46.el5.i386.rpm

[root@oracle Server]# rpm -ivh libstdc++-devel-4.1.2-46.el5.i386.rpm

[root@oracle Server]# rpm -ivh make-3.81-3.el5.i386.rpm

[root@oracle Server]# rpm -ivh pdksh-5.2.14-36.el5.i386.rpm

[root@oracle Server]# rpm -ivh sysstat-7.0.2-3.el5.i386.rpm

[root@oracle Server]# rpm -ivh setarch-2.0-1.1.i386.rpm

3.修改/etc/hosts文件

[root@oracle ~]# echo "192.168.101.88 oracle.junjie.com" 》/etc/hosts

4.新建用户和组

[root@oracle ~]# groupadd dba

[root@oracle ~]# groupadd oinstall

[root@oracle ~]# groupadd oper

[root@oracle ~]# useradd -g oinstall -G dba,oper oracle

[root@oracle ~]# echo 'zhu.110' |passwd --stdin oracle

Changing password for user oracle.

passwd: all authentication tokens updated successfully.

5.添加文件

[root@oracle ~]# vim /etc/sysctl.conf

kernel.shmall = 2097152

kernel.shmmax = 2147483648

kernel.shmmni = 4096

kernel.sem = 250 32000 100 128

fs.file-max = 65536

net.ipv4.ip_local_port_range = 1024 65000

net.core.rmem_default = 1048576

net.core.rmem_max = 1048576

net.core.wmem_default = 262144

net.core.wmem_max = 262144

[root@oracle ~]# vim /etc/security/limits.conf

oracle soft nproc 2047

oracle hard nproc 16384

oracle soft nofile 1024

oracle hard nofile 65536

[root@oracle ~]# vim /etc/pam.d/login

session required /lib/security/pam_limits.so

session required pam_limits.so

[root@oracle ~]# vim /etc/profile

if [ $USER = "oracle" ]; then

if [ $SHELL = "/bin/ksh" ]; then

ulimit -p 16384

ulimit -n 65536

else

ulimit -u 16384 -n 65536

fi

fi

6. 新建文件,修改权限

[root@oracle ~]# mkdir /u01

[root@oracle ~]# mkdir -pv /u01/app/oracle

mkdir: created directory `/u01/app'

mkdir: created directory `/u01/app/oracle'

[root@oracle ~]# chown -R oracle:oinstall /u01/app/oracle/

[root@oracle ~]# chmod -R 775 /u01/app/oracle/

[root@oracle ~]# mkdir /u01/flash_recovery_area

[root@oracle ~]# chown oracle:oinstall /u01/flash_recovery_area/

[root@oracle ~]# chmod 755 /u01/flash_recovery_area/

二。安装oracle

2.1.添加以下几行

[root@oracle ~]# su - oracle

[oracle@oracle ~]$ vim .bash_profile

export ORACLE_BASE=/u01/app/oracle

export ORACLE_HOME=/u01/app/oracle/product/10.2.0

export ORACLE_SID=xjzhujunjie

[oracle@oracle ~]$ . .bash_profile

[oracle@oracle ~]$ env | grep ORA

ORACLE_SID=xjzhujunjie

ORACLE_BASE=/u01/app/oracle

ORACLE_HOME=/u01/app/oracle/product/10.2.0

2.2更换光盘

[root@oracle ~]# umount /mnt/cdrom/

我使用的光盘是:(ora102forlinux.iso)

[root@oracle ~]# mount /dev/cdrom /mnt/cdrom/

mount: block device /dev/cdrom is write-protected, mounting read-only

[root@oracle ~]# ll /mnt/cdrom/

total 2

dr-xr-xr-x 1 root root 2048 Jul 2 2005 database

[root@oracle ~]#

2.3 测试图形界面($)

测试图形界面($)出现以下为正常,

若不成功则:#xhost local:oracle(后到VM中测试)

2.4 测试图形界面($)

2.5 运行以下命令,进行安装

超详细图解安装,如下:

[1] [2] [3] [4]


Oracle优化的几点经验
Oracle表空间和数据文件管理
Oracle Instant Client的安装和使用
oracle将表名和字段名变为大写
小表缓存到内存简析
ORACLE分组统计
Oracle中的kfed和kfod
Oracle 11g windows备份脚本
oracle远程登录解决办法
oracle 11g的ORA-28001处理

编辑推荐

? [安装配置]成功的例子- php oci8 oracle
? [安装配置]在同一台机器上装了双实例,出现的问题
? [安装配置]Oracle启动停止命令
? [备份恢复]Oracle10g的新特性flashback drop
? [备份恢复]Oracle数据库文件恢复与备份思路
? [开发技术]Oracle中表的四种连接方式讲解
? [性能调优]浅谈Oracle性能优化可能出现的问题
? [开发技术]Oracle数据库中表的四种连接方式讲解
? [性能调优]Oracle性能调整的十大要点
? [性能调优]数据库设计规范化的五个要求

相关产品和培训

文章评论

 友情推荐链接

?Asp源码 PHP源码
?CGI源码 JSP源码
?建站书籍教程
?服务器软件 .net源码
?建站工具软件

?IDC资讯大全
?机房品质万里行
?IDC托管必备知识
?网站推广优化
?全国IDC报价

人气教程排行